Lot Description
For restoration: a good large pair of 19th century Chinese porcelain vases. Each of baluster form, the waisted neck decorated with a 'greek key' frieze and cloud motifs over fan-shaped panels of perching birds, scattered flowerheads and a lower frieze of stiff leaves on a hand-drawn blue diaperwork ground, the body with a finelt worked collar of flowers and scrolls over zoomorphic mask handles, further flowers and panels (including birds, and larger shaped panels of landscapes) with matching diaperwork ground, over lower lappet frieze and yellow ground base, turquoise ground beneath with Qianlong seal mark to each, 19.75", (50ocm) high, (both at fault), (2).

Condition Report
First has a triangular section of neck reattached - 5" wide x 3.5" deep., plus another 4" rim crack, and some rim losses at tops of these cracks.
Second has more extensive damage including rim losses, several reattached sections, significant cracks through panels etc.
Sold as seen, for restoration.
